欧美vvv,亚洲第一成人在线,亚洲成人欧美日韩在线观看,日本猛少妇猛色XXXXX猛叫

新聞資訊

    在制作模板的過程中經(jīng)常會用到一些默認(rèn)沒有的字段,為此以以及以上的基礎(chǔ)上做了一個關(guān)于自定義字段的添加和自定義字段在模板中的調(diào)用方法。 在制作模板的過程中經(jīng)常會用到一些默認(rèn)沒有的字段,如:

    這里的價格的調(diào)用,默認(rèn)是沒有這個標(biāo)簽的,那我們?nèi)绻麑崿F(xiàn)這個價格的調(diào)用呢? 在這里我們就需要使用到模型里的自定義字段了,下面我們以.6為例介紹一下字段的添加和調(diào)用方法。(5.3版本后的所以版本的自定義字段的添加和調(diào)用相同) 首先我們打開網(wǎng)站后臺,點擊左側(cè)的“核心”,找到模型管理,這是就可以看到“內(nèi)容模型管理”的選項卡了。如圖:

    點擊進入“內(nèi)容模型管理”這是右側(cè)會顯示相應(yīng)的各個模型了,下面我們以文章模型為例講解自定義字段的添加。

    點擊右側(cè)的更改小圖

    標(biāo)進入文章模型的管理頁面。 這是我們會看到有“基本設(shè)置”和“字段管理”2個選項。我們選擇字段管理選項進入。

    進入以后我

    們會看到有個“添加新字段”的按鈕

    點擊“添加新字段”按鈕進入,這時看到的就是添加字段的界面了。 我們以上面講到的價格字段為例進行一個實例操作的講解,如下圖:

    全部添加好后點擊確定即可。然后我們進入欄目管理,開始添加內(nèi)容,打開添加內(nèi)容頁面后我們會看到一個關(guān)于價格的內(nèi)容輸入框。

    這個就是我們剛剛添加到關(guān)于價格的字段。 到這里就已經(jīng)講完關(guān)于自定義字段的一個添加過程,對于自定義字段的添加需要活學(xué)活用才能將這個功能的潛力完全發(fā)揮出來。下面講一下關(guān)于自定義字段在模板中的的調(diào)用。 我們以在首頁調(diào)用為例: 模板中默認(rèn)調(diào)用文章標(biāo)題的標(biāo)簽如下:

    {dede:arclist row=6 titlelen=32} 
  • [field:title/]
  • {/dede:arclist}

    那么我們調(diào)用自定義字段就是在這個基礎(chǔ)上加以修改來實現(xiàn)的,我們還是以最開始提到的價格為例,具體標(biāo)簽表現(xiàn)為:

     {dede:arclist row=8 titlelen=32 addfields='jiage' channelid='1'} 
  • ¥[field:jiage/]起[field:title/]
  • {/dede:arclist}

    我們可以看到和第一個標(biāo)簽比較起來有2個不同的地方: 1, 在{dede: row=6 =32}處多出了='jiage' ='1' ,其中='jiage'表示的是指定要獲得的字段 ='字段1,字段' ='1' 表示的是該字段是屬于哪個模型的,我們這里是指文章模型里添加到所以=的值為1..。 確定文章模型的的ID是多少,我們里在文章模型管理里找到如下圖紅色框內(nèi)的就是模型ID.

    2,還多出一個“[field:jiage/]”這個就是我們在添加字段時添加到字段名了。如果你需要在列表頁中的{dede:list}里調(diào)用自定義字段的話直接添加 “[field:jiage/]” 就可以了,但前提條件是你添加字段的時候必須選擇了該項參數(shù)。

    以上就是關(guān)于自定義字段的添加和調(diào)用方法。 另外也可以通過在數(shù)據(jù)庫中添加字段,修改模板文件也能實現(xiàn)的。比如編輯欄目的時候,添加自己想要的欄目的自定義設(shè)置,比如添加欄目關(guān)鍵字等等。下面是具體的操作。第一步:我們要進去mysql 數(shù)據(jù)庫里添加字段,自己命名好!比如我下面添加了一個欄目搜索關(guān)鍵字字段,當(dāng)然你字段可以自己新建,找到表 (這個是欄目模型的數(shù)據(jù)庫表,前面是你安裝的表名)然后點擊

    在點擊添加字段

    添加字段

    到這里數(shù)據(jù)庫字段添加好了。 接下來我們開始做后臺。大家寫找到后臺欄目管理模版! 要更改的 2個 D:\www\dede\ 模版:.htm、.htm 下面就演示一個

    然后添加 字段表單,這個一般大家都會的 我添加的代碼是:

     欄目搜索關(guān)鍵字:     

    這里注意了。表單的name 和id 要和添加的 mysql表字段一樣,不應(yīng)的話。還要多寫個取值代碼。一樣的話。默認(rèn)會自動取的,然后我們做最后一部,把數(shù)據(jù)添加進去。 大家找到: D:\www\dede\.php 目錄可能和大家不一樣 也就是后臺 里面的 .php,.php .php要改的地方有:38行

    $upquery = "Update `dede_arctype` set issend='$issend', sortrank='$sortrank', typename='$typename', typedir='$typedir', isdefault='$isdefault', defaultname='$defaultname', issend='$issend', ishidden='$ishidden', channeltype='$channeltype', tempindex='$tempindex', templist='$templist', temparticle='$temparticle', namerule='$namerule', namerule2='$namerule2', ispart='$ispart', corank='$corank', description='$description', keywords='$keywords', moresite='$moresite', `cross`='$cross', `content`='$content', `crossid`='$crossid', `smalltypes`='$smalltypes' $uptopsql where id='$id' "; 

    sql語句里面添加我們剛才的 字段進去。也就是下面這個代碼

     $upquery = "Update `dede_arctype` set issend='$issend', sortrank='$sortrank', typename='$typename', typedir='$typedir', isdefault='$isdefault', defaultname='$defaultname', issend='$issend', ishidden='$ishidden', channeltype='$channeltype', tempindex='$tempindex', templist='$templist', temparticle='$temparticle', namerule='$namerule', namerule2='$namerule2', ispart='$ispart', corank='$corank', description='$description', keywords='$keywords', moresite='$moresite', `cross`='$cross', `content`='$content', `crossid`='$crossid', `smalltypes`='$smalltypes', `lanmukeywrod`='$lanmukeywrod' $uptopsql where id='$id' "; 

    看到了 這個是添加的:``='$',這個是更新欄目的。.php添加。也是同樣的辦法。 更改地址有:63行和196行。也是同樣辦法。添加字段信息 到sql里去 更改后的代碼:63行:

    $queryTemplate = "insert into `dede_arctype`(reid,topid,sortrank,typename,typedir,isdefault,defaultname,issend,channeltype, tempindex,templist,temparticle,modname,namerule,namerule2,ispart,corank,description,keywords,moresite,siteurl,sitepath,ishidden,`cross`,`crossid`,`content`,`smalltypes`,`lanmukeywrod`) Values('~reid~','~topid~','~rank~','~typename~','~typedir~','$isdefault','$defaultname','$issend','$channeltype', '$tempindex','$templist','$temparticle','default','$namerule','$namerule2','0','0','','','0','','','0','0','0','','','$lanmukeywrod')"; 

    添加了 196行:

    $in_query = "insert into `dede_arctype`(reid,topid,sortrank,typename,typedir,isdefault,defaultname,issend,channeltype, tempindex,templist,temparticle,modname,namerule,namerule2, ispart,corank,description,keywords,moresite,siteurl,sitepath,ishidden,`cross`,`crossid`,`content`,`smalltypes`,`lanmukeywrod`) Values('$reid','$topid','$sortrank','$typename','$typedir','$isdefault','$defaultname','$issend','$channeltype', '$tempindex','$templist','$temparticle','default','$namerule','$namerule2', '$ispart','$corank','$description','$keywords','$moresite','$siteurl','$sitepath','$ishidden','$cross','$crossid','$content','$smalltypes','$lanmukeywrod')"; 

    下面說下 如何調(diào)用到前臺

    {dede:field.lanmukeywrod/}

    在模版里調(diào)用這個就可以了,如果大家是別的字段也是一樣的調(diào)用下列標(biāo)記沒有被關(guān)閉,后面換成字段名稱就可以了。 另外關(guān)于自定義字段的完全刪除。 在修改網(wǎng)站的時候由于需要增加自定義字段,后來不需要的時候,發(fā)現(xiàn)自定義字段無法刪除。 于是找到了數(shù)據(jù)庫的這個表,看到了自定義字段,刪除后,在后臺的模型中看到自定義字段還存在,很多朋友都是做到這一步,就不知道如何做了。而且發(fā)布文章的時候還有錯誤,提示自定義字段找不到,而無法發(fā)布文章。 原來在這里面也就是模型配置里面還存在這個自定義字段,進入數(shù)據(jù)庫表下下列標(biāo)記沒有被關(guān)閉,然后點擊瀏覽內(nèi)容,你會發(fā)現(xiàn)字段里面的內(nèi)容還存在這個自定義字段。 以下為引用的內(nèi)容:

    default='' rename='' page='split'/>   只要我們刪除

    這樣就可以了,問題解決了。

網(wǎng)站首頁   |    關(guān)于我們   |    公司新聞   |    產(chǎn)品方案   |    用戶案例   |    售后服務(wù)   |    合作伙伴   |    人才招聘   |   

友情鏈接: 餐飲加盟

地址:北京市海淀區(qū)    電話:010-     郵箱:@126.com

備案號:冀ICP備2024067069號-3 北京科技有限公司版權(quán)所有